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, musty odors can be a sign of moisture trapped in your walls, floors, or ceilings. If you can’t shake these smells, it’s time to call our team for an assessment.

Warped or Sagging Floors

If your floors are warped or sagging, it’s likely due to water damage. Don’t wait until it’s too late, call us today to schedule a consultation.

Water Stains or Discoloration on Walls

Water stains or discoloration on your walls can be a sign of hidden water damage. Don’t ignore these signs, call our team for a thorough inspection and assessment.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of moisture issues. If you’re experiencing this in your home, it’s time to call our team for a solution.

Swollen or Buckled Drywall

Swollen or buckled drywall is a sign of water damage. Don’t wait until it’s too late, call our team for an assessment and repair.

Unusual Sounds or Noises

If you’re hearing unusual sounds or noises in your home, such as creaking or groaning, it may be a sign of water damage. Don’t ignore these signs, call our team for a thorough inspection and assessment.

Common Questions About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al

What causes hydrostatic pressure water removal in New Hope, MN?

Minnehaha Falls and other heavy rainfall events in our area can overwhelm the soil and foundations of homes, leading to hydrostatic pressure water removal. Also, poor drainage, clogged gutters, and cracked foundations can all contribute to this issue.

How long does the drying and dehumidification process take?

The drying and dehumidification process typically takes 3-5 days, depending on the severity of the damage and the efficiency of our equipment. But, this can vary depending on the specific circumstances of your property.

Is it safe to live in a home with water damage?

No, it’s not safe to live in a home with water damage. Excess moisture can lead to mold growth, structural damage, and other health hazards. It’s essential to address water damage quickly and professionally to prevent further problems.
